As a Commercial Counsel (Florham Park, NJ), you create chemistry by...
Providing pragmatic, strategic and day-to-day legal and compliance counselling, advice, training and support to business management and operational personnel of BASF.
Drafting, reviewing and negotiating a variety of agreements, including product sales, raw material supply, custom manufacturing, distribution, and services agreements, in support of day-to-day transactions.
Developing and providing compliance and legal training on relevant company policies, procedures and legal issues, and participating in U.S. and Global team meetings to share best practices.
Leading internal and external negotiations, helping to structure transactions and drafting or reviewing transactional documents ranging from the simple to the complex.
Interpreting rights and obligations as set forth in agreements to assist in resolving disputes and engaging and managing relationships with outside legal counsel, as needed.
Serving as legal counsel on M&A transactions, as well as other strategic projects for business units; and
Identifying issues requiring input and support from business and functional support units (e.g., intellectual property, tax, litigation, regulatory, and/or compliance counsel, risk management, finance and EH&S) and engaging such cross-functional teams to ensure complete and efficient resolution of all matters and transactions.
If you have...
J.D. from an accredited U.S. law school; License to practice law in the U.S.
At least 7 years of experience working in a law firm and/or practicing as in-house counsel in the area of commercial transactions, including sales, procurement and/ or manufacturing, with a team-oriented, collaborative work style; experience analyzing, preparing and conducting strategic negotiations; proficiency in US antitrust laws preferred.
Strong negotiation and communication skills (written and oral), including the ability to pragmatically and concisely communicate complex legal issues to non-lawyers.
Demonstrated well-developed, real-world business judgment with the ability to effectively influence, communicate and interact with diverse groups at all levels of the organization as well as with external stakeholders.
Demonstrated ability to adapt to a changing environment, work independently and make sound decisions within BASF’s risk tolerances.
